Overall, I was pleasantly surprised by this coat because I was expecting an inferior copy of poor quality but this feels really authentic. Stiching and finishing generally good. Jacket is 65/35% polyester cotton. Liner 100% polyester. Appears to have been manufactured in Germany by Miltec. Detailing (shaping, pleats and fastenings) all well executed. No loose threads. Buttons securely attached. Metal zip. Four large external pockets with metal popper fasteners. Liner attaches with buttons inside. Hood inside collar stores flat when not in use. I normally wear M/L size but ordered M and got a pretty good fit with liner. This is quite a substantial and warm jacket and is described as cold weather clothing on the interior label. Could probably go to a S if I was looking for a more fitted summer look with liner removed. My only slight disappointment was that the liner wasn't finished in a way that allows it to be worn separately, since it would actually have made a decent quilted jacket if the seams had not been visible from the outside, but for £45 or thereabouts, a real bargain. It feels very new, so if you are looking for something more distressed and vintage, probably not for you, but washing and wear will undoubtedly soften the lines a bit
